Contact our team today

If you have any questions or comments, please use the form below to contact us. You can also reach us by phone or email.

French: +1 418-317-5956

English : +1 855-278-2520

We are always happy to hear from our customers and will do our best to respond quickly to all requests. 

Thank you for your confidence!